Are there generic 4k horizontal and vertical bezels? Right now I'm using "chelnov" as a generic horizontal bezel and "1945kiii" as the vertical. I just copied and renamed them to "generich" and "genericv" respectively. I then reference these in 2 separate single line inis: horizont.ini = fallback_artwork generich vertical.ini = fallback_artwork genericv Dedicated generic bezels would be a GREAT addition to the packs since MAME supports fallback bezel artwork in the mame.ini -
